About this home

Welcome to 14506 Benefit St. #103 – A Stylish, Turn-Key Condo in Prime Sherman Oaks! Tucked away on a quiet, tree-lined street in the desirable South of the Blvd neighborhood, this beautifully upgraded 1-bedroom, 1-bathroom end-unit offers an exceptional blend of comfort, style, and location. With 835 sq. ft. of bright and airy living space, this rarely available single-level condo features a seamless open floor plan, modern updates, and thoughtful design throughout. Inside, enjoy new flooring, fresh paint, recessed lighting, and a cozy gas fireplace that adds warmth and charm. The well-appointed kitchen provides ample cabinet and storage space, while central air ensures year-round comfort. The spacious primary bedroom includes a custom Murphy bed, built-in desk, additional storage, and a generous walk-in closet. A brand-new roof was installed in 2024, and exterior of the building recently painted enhancing long-term value. This move-in ready, turn-key residence is ideal for corporate relocation or anyone seeking a hassle-free transition—with furniture, kitchenware, and household items included or negotiable. Community amenities include a sparkling pool and spa, extra storage, and secured gated parking. The HOA covers water, gas, and earthquake insurance. Ideally located just a short stroll to The Village at Sherman Oaks and minutes from Beverly Glen Blvd, the 405, and 101 freeways, this home offers unbeatable convenience.
